The Breakdown of THCA Flower and THC

In the world of cannabis, understanding the nuances between various compounds is crucial. Two key players often cause confusion: THCA flower and THC. While both are derived from the cannabis plant, they possess distinct characteristics and effects. Tetrahydrocannabinolic acid (THCA) exists in its raw form within cannabis strains. It's a precursor to THC and {remains inactive until heated|{undergoes transformation when heated|is transformed through heat. This heating process, known as decarboxylation, converts THCA into the psychoactive compound we know as THC.

THC is the primary psychoactive ingredient responsible for the "high" associated with cannabis use. It interacts with receptors in the brain, altering perception, mood, and cognitive function. THCA, on the other hand, doesn't directly produce these effects in its raw form.
